Igne are seeking a Lead Driller to join the team in Hamilton, Glasgow.
The Waterwells division of Igne specializes in providing cost-effective, high-quality, and independent water supplies to both private and public sector clients. With over 350 years of combined experience in borehole drilling, they are one of the UK’s leading water supply specialists.
The successful candidate will organise equipment, operate and run drilling sites on both domestic and commercial water well drilling projects, to industry technical specifications and Company procedures.

We are Igne Group Limited, a synergetic amalgamation of six companies, renowned within our respective fields, with over 350 years of combined experience. A one-stop-shop for pre- and post-construction services. Igne’s six service categories are: site investigation, testing, unexploded ordnance, water wells, geothermal, and geo-environmental.
